Zusammenfassung:According to one aspect of the present invention, a multidirectional input device is characterized by comprising a housing, an operation member that can tilt, a first coordinated member that has a first axial support part that is supported on the housing so as to be capable of rotating around a first rotational axis such that the first coordinated member rotates in coordination with the tilting of the operation member, a second coordinated member that has a second axial support part that is supported on the housing so as to be capable of rotating around a second rotational axis that intersects the first rotational axis such that the second coordinated member rotates in coordination with the titling of the operation member, a first urging member that urges the operation member so as to press the first axial support part of the first coordinated member onto the housing and applies return force that returns the operation member to a center position to the operation member, a second urging member that urges the second coordinated member so as to press the second axial support part onto the housing, and a rotation sensor that detects the rotation of each of the first coordinated member and the second coordinated member. The present invention suppresses separation of the axial support parts of the coordinated members from a reception portion of the housing that receives the axial support parts, improves the operability of the operation member, and prevents deviation of the operation member when the operation member returns to the center position.
